About Catholic Schools Office Diocese of Lismore

Mission: Enabling students to achieve the fullness of life

Vision: To strengthen Catholic identity and mission and support quality teaching and learning to promote optimal student outcomes.

The Diocese of Lismore extends along the coastal strip of NSW from Tweed Heads in the north to Laurieton in the south and Dorrigo to the west in the foothills of the Great Dividing Range.

Catholic education in the Diocese of Lismore is a long standing provider of school education on the north coast of New South Wales. 45 Catholic primary and secondary schools with a combined student enrolment of over 18,500 students, operate in all major urban centres and many smaller towns from Tweed Heads to Laurieton. 

All Catholic schools seek to provide a comprehensive, quality education in a welcoming and secure environment.
